The differences between reel operators and smt operators can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, an smt operator has an average salary of $33,647, which is higher than the $27,177 average annual salary of a reel operator.
| Reel Operator | SMT Operator | |
| Yearly salary | $27,177 | $33,647 |
| Hourly rate | $13.07 | $16.18 |
| Growth rate | - | 2% |
| Number of jobs | 30,222 | 54,826 |
| Job satisfaction | - | - |
| Most common degree | High School Diploma, 46% | Associate Degree, 32% |
| Average age | 43 | 43 |
| Years of experience | - | - |
